Project Delivery Methods Lag Behind Construction Industry Innovation
Traditional project delivery methods are evolving too slowly to keep pace with the rapid advancements in the construction industry, necessitating a shift towards more integrated, people-centered, and sustainability-focused approaches.
Buildings · 2020
Key Findings
- 01Project delivery methods evolve at a slower rate than the construction industry itself.
- 02Emerging selection criteria include risk, health and wellbeing, sustainability goals, and technological innovations.
- 03Future project delivery methods should be digitally integrated, people-centered, and sustainability-focused.
- 04Advanced AI techniques can be leveraged to develop decision support models for selecting optimal delivery methods.

Limitations
The study's findings are based on a literature review, which may be subject to publication bias. The proposed framework is conceptual and requires real-world testing.
Reliability & validity
The reliability of the findings depends on the comprehensiveness of the literature reviewed. Validity is enhanced by the identification of a clear gap and the proposal of a framework for future development.
